Ponzano Romano Sunshine Hours by Month
Sunshine is key to understanding how a place experiences its seasons. This page shows the total number of hours of direct sunlight per month and the average hours per day in Ponzano Romano, Lazio, Italy. Long-term data from 1990 to 2020 was used to calculate these averages.
Monthly hours of sunshine
Sunshine in Ponzano Romano varies greatly throughout the year. The sunniest month, July, reaches an impressive 332 hours, while December, the darkest month, offers only 112 hours. The total annual amount of sun is 2473 hours.
Daily hours of sunshine
In Ponzano Romano, summer days are longer and more sunny, with daily sunshine hours peaking at 11.1 hours in July. As the darker season arrives, the brightness of the sun becomes less. December sees a soft sun for only 3.7 hours per day.
Ponzano Romano vs Major Cities: Sunshine Compared
Ponzano Romano enjoys an average of 2473 hours of sunshine annually. Let’s compare this with some popular tourist destinations:
The city of Rome, Italy, experiences 2470 hours of sunshine annually, adding to its charm as a year-round tourist destination.
In contrast, Tromsø , Norway, receives only about 1270 hours of sunshine per year, known for the polar night with no sunlight for weeks during winter.
Boston, USA, enjoys 2629 hours of sunshine annually, with distinct seasons and many bright, sunny days.
In Brisbane, Australia, the annual sunshine averages 2999 hours, making it one of Australia’s sunniest cities.

November, Ponzano Romano’s wettest month, receives 32 mm (1.3 in) of rainfall and has a maximum daytime temperature of 16°C (61°F). During the driest month July you can expect a temperature of 32°C (90°F).
